Auction checklist
Go to several auctions before you start bidding to get a feel of how they work and the procedures to follow.
Decide in advance how much you want to spend.
Make sure you have inspected everything carefully before bidding, as you may have limited redress.
Read the catalogue and sale notice small print carefully.
If you are buying something expensive, such as a car, take someone along with you who has some experience.
If you have a problem selling something you bought at auction, you have to take the matter up with the seller, not the auction house.
If something is described as "sold as seen" you have no redress.
